The Hexadecimal Color #431817 is a contrast shade of Maroon. #431817 RGB value is rgb(67, 24, 23). RGB Color Model of #431817 consists of 26% red, 9% green and 9% blue. HSL color Mode of #431817 has 1°(degrees) Hue, 49% Saturation and 18% Lightness. #431817 color has an wavelength of 619.37037n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#431817 is #663333.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#431817 is #411. The Closest Color to #431817 is #800000. Official Name of #431817 Hex Code is Paco.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#431817 is 0 Cyan 64 Magenta 66 Yellow 74 Black and #431817 CMY is 0, 64, 66.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#431817 is hsl(1,49,18,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(1, 66, 26).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#431817 is 2.8, 1.91, 1.03.
Hex8 Value of #431817 is #431817FF. Decimal Value of #431817 is 4397079 and Octal Value of #431817 is 20614027. Binary Value of #431817 is 1000011, 11000, 10111 and Android of #431817 is 4282587159 / 0xff431817.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#431817 is 0.487, 0.333, 0.333 and YIQ Color Space of #431817 is 36.743, 25.945, 8.7833.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#431817 is 2.71, 1.28, 1.05.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#431817 is 15.01, 20.77, 11.16.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#431817 is 15.01, 24.67, 5.72.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#431817 is 15.01, 23.58, 28.25. Hunter Lab variable of #431817 is 13.82, 11.98, 5.26.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#431817

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
